Open From the list, select one of the following:
• Yes—Allows any device, regardless of its WEP
keys, to authenticate and attempt to associate. This is
the recommended setting.
• No—Does not allow any device, regardless of its
WEP keys, to authenticate and attempt to associate.
Shared From the list, select one of the following:
• Yes—Tells the access point to send a plain-text,
shared key query to any device attempting to
associate with the access point. This query can leave
the access point open to a known-text attack from
intruders. This is not as secure as the Open setting.
• No—Does not allow the access point to send a
plain-text, shared key query to any device attempting
to associate with the access point.
Network-EAP From the list, select one of the following:
• Yes—Allows EAP-enabled client devices to
authenticate through the access point.
• No—Does not allow EAP-enabled client devices to
authenticate through the access point.
Require EAP
Open From the list, select one of the following:
• Yes—Use this option if you use open and EAP
authentication to block client devices that are not
using EAP from authenticating through the access
point.
• No—Use this option if you do not use open and EAP
authentication.
